Output 3d21564a4119a221867ec0a19ce120c3e54f79c41989ffc5e55bda9c3a861027:1

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375d23e90ee6d65b08e4ec1d162777519414c OP_EQUAL
address
3BMEXbkRbriayyVDrCumZF8y6JnYktFCWo
transaction
3d21564a4119a221867ec0a19ce120c3e54f79c41989ffc5e55bda9c3a861027
spent
true